NE 400 Heat Transfer in Nuclear Systems

±··¡Ìý400ÌýÌýHeat Transfer in Nuclear SystemsÌýÌý(3 credit hours)ÌýÌý

Introduction to the concepts and principles of heat generation and removal in reactor systems. Power cycles, reactor heat sources, analytic and numerical solutions to conduction problems in reactor components and fuel elements, heat transfer in reactor fuel bundles and heat exchangers. Problem sets emphasize design principles. Credit will not be given for both ±··¡Ìý400 and ±··¡Ìý500.

Typically offered in Spring only

Nuclear Engineering (Minor)

The minor in Nuclear Engineering is intended to allow engineering students to develop an understanding of the fundamental concepts and practices of nuclear engineering.  It is designed to provide students with the essentials necessary for employment in nuclear- related fields.  Students considering advanced study should also benefit from the minor in nuclear engineering.
